Journal of Chemical and Engineering Data, Vol.39, No.3, 572-577, 1994
Measurement of the Vapor-Pressure of Several Low-Volatility Organochlorine Chemicals at Low-Temperatures with a Gas Saturation Method
The vapor pressures of hexachlorobenzene, gamma-hexachlorocyclohexane, p,p’-DDT, i.e., 1,1-bis(4-chlorophenyl)-2,2,2-trichloroethane, 4-monochlorobiphenyl, 4,4’-dichlorobiphenyl, 2,3,4,5-tetrachlorobiphenyl and 2,2’,4,4’,6,6’-hexachlorobiphenyl were measured in the temperature range -30 to +40-degrees-C with a gas saturation technique. Coefficients describing the temperature dependence of these vapor pressures are reported. Enthalpies of sublimation derived from these data show no significant temperature dependence in the temperature range investigated.
